29.05.2009 - Swiss entrepreneur acquires a majority stake in Eternit Österreich
Vienna, on 29 May 2009 – The FibreCem Group, held by the Swiss entrepreneur Bernhard Alpstaeg, or rather Eternit (Schweiz) AG acquired a majority stake in the Austrian Eternit Group, Eternit-Werke Ludwig Hatschek AG, from the CROSS Industries Group. This company, founded by the inventor of an entirely new material called Eternit in 1894 and situated in Vöcklabruck, Upper Austria, has a long history as traditional Austrian producer. It manufactures fibre cement products of the brand “Eternit” as well as concrete roof panels and runs the company “Dach und Wand”, operating a wholesale business for roofing materials.
The Austrian Eternit Group currently employs 455 people and achieved revenues in the amount of approximately €124m in the previous business year. The FibreCem Group, which comprises Eternit (Schweiz) AG with its production facilities in Niederurnen and Payerne, Promat AG (Winterthur), ESAL d.o.o (Slovenia) and Bachl Baustoffe Porschendorf (Germany), has about 700 employees and has budgeted revenues in the amount of €104m for 2009.
Both Groups, which have been operating in different geographic markets so far, have a similar product strategy in common: In the roofing segment, it refers to the manufacturing of high-quality roof panels and corrugated sheets made of Eternit fibre cement, ideally suitable for usage under alpine climate. Moreover, the wide range of façade panels does also create synergies.
Entrepreneur Bernhard Alpstaeg remarks that “We are particularly pleased about having such a renowned, long-established company like EWLH on our side. We strongly intend to strengthen Eternit’s production facility in Vöcklabruck and thus secure it in a sustainable way. Bundling different strengths creates synergies, thus makes sense and is in our interest. Only in collaboration with our partners in Austria, Slovenia and Germany we are able to achieve our goals: to become N°1 in the European fibre cement market. Let’s do it – with enthusiasm and honest work!”
According to Stefan Pierer, Chairman of the Management Board of CROSS Industries AG, “Combining the two company groups makes it possible to gain a significant role in the international roofing and façade market. In particular technological leadership of both companies in the fibre cement segment enables them a clear distinction from other suppliers. I wish the new group all the best for the future.”
The takeover is subject to approval by antitrust authorities.
